New Federal Reserve News Agency: Trump has made it "harder" for the next Federal Reserve chairman.
The market worries that Trump's public belittling and pressure on Powell will leave an indelible "original sin" for Powell's successor. Regardless of who the next chairman is, the independence of the Federal Reserve will be in question. An independent central bank is often seen as more objective and professional, making its decisions more likely to guide market expectations and stabilize the economy. Since President Clinton's era, most U.S. presidents have adopted a stance of "non-interference" with the Federal Reserve.
